I refer to the letter Occupation Of Public Land (Anthony Cassar, June 10) about Church Street in Paceville and the car park in front of Tiguglio.

With regard to the Church Street issue, the board of directors of the Roads Division will be reviewing the matter during its next meeting.

The review will take place on the basis of a traffic impact assessment being prepared.

Details of the board decision will be communicated to the public once a final decision is taken.

As to the issue relating to the temporary use of the car park in front of Tiguglio, on February 19, the St Julians local council informed the Malta Transport Authority that, together with the Ministry for Tourism, it was going to organise a number of events during the months of May, June and August.

Where there is no major impact on safety, accessibility or traffic flows, the local council - a body that represents the interests of the local community where the event is being held - can organise such events.
